"Scientists Study Lasting Health Effects of Toxic Spill" [1]

"It's been seven years since a poisonous cloud spread across tiny Graniteville, S.C., after a deadly train wreck rocked the gritty textile community. And since that tragic morning in January 2005, a group of researchers has been tracking the lingering effects of chlorine on the public health."



Sammy Fretwell reports for the Columbia, SC, State August 30, 2012. [2]
